Explanation:
When a point (x, y) is reflected over the x-axis the new coordinates will be
(x', y') where x'x = x and y' = -y
In other words, the transformation is
(x, y) ⇒ ((x, -y)
Point E is (-3, 2) . When transformed e' becomes (-3, -2)
The only choice where E' is (-3, -2) is choice B
